Merger Creates One of North America's Largest Greenhouse Produce Suppliers
20 Ontario Greenhouse Growers Amalgamate Operations
Twenty Ontario greenhouse growers have amalgamated their resources to better serve the produce industry. The new company becomes one of the largest greenhouse produce marketing operations in North America, representing approximately 200 acres, 150 of which are the combined owner’s family operations.
